Capital Grants Project Unveiling

We are passionate about providing our students with a vibrant learning environment that enables them to aspire to their highest potential. On Thursday, 23 September 2021 (Week 10, Term 3), we unveiled our new Junior School Classrooms, Facilities and Learning Hub.

“The Learning Hub is the real boom for us, as we’ve never had one before.” Mr Bruce Hicks said.

These new facilities will further enhance the learning environment and be used well by the Year 11 and 12 students to study.

Another benefit is that these two new classrooms have given us the space to create a Small Class where students who can’t study and learn in the mainstream class have a space to learn. 

We thank the Capital Grants Program for having confidence in the future of our students at Tyndale. We know the students will get a lot of use out of these new facilities as it provides a great learning environment.

Our Year 12 Leaders, along with Mr Bruce Hicks and Tony Pasin, unveiled the plaques. There was a great sense of confidence and joy at the event. We were blessed with a sunny 23-degree day and the freedom for all students and special guests to be present on the day.
